16110acaa2Added support for a global relative mouse motion option. When true and on a secondary screen and locked to the screen (via scroll lock) mouse motion is sent as motion deltas. When true and scroll lock is toggled off the mouse is warped to the secondary screen's center so the server knows where it is. This option is intended to support games and other programs that repeatedly warp the mouse to the center of the screen. This change adds general and X11 support but not win32. The option name is "relativeMouseMoves".

54b3884ebaRemoved use of mbrtowc, wcrtomb, and mbsinit. Many platforms didn't support them and the emulated versions were just as good except for a performance problem with excessive locking and unlocking of a mutex. So this also changes IArchString to provide string rather than character conversion so we can lock the mutex once per string rather than once per character.

8d99fd2511Checkpoint. Converted X11 to new keyboard state tracking design. This new design is simpler. For keyboard support, clients need only implement 4 virtual methods on a class derived from CKeyState and one trivial method in the class derived from CPlatformScreen, which is now the superclass of platform screens instead of IPlatformScreen. Keyboard methods have been removed from IPlatformScreen, IPrimaryScreen and ISecondaryScreen. Also, all keyboard state tracking is now in exactly one place (the CKeyState subclass) rather than in CScreen, the platform screen, and the key mapper. Still need to convert Win32.

1ccb92b888Fixed BSD unblockPollSocket(). Was signaling to break out of poll() but there was a race condition where the thread trying to unblock poll() could send the signal before the polling thread had entered poll(). Now using a pipe and polling on that and the client's sockets, and just writing a byte into the pipe to unblock poll. This persists until the next call to poll() so we might force poll() to return once unnecessarily but that's not a problem. This change makes the BSD code similar to the winsock code, which uses a winsock event instead of a pipe.
